Baggage Allowance for Checked Baggage

When it comes to checked baggage, Philippine Airlines offers varying allowances depending on the travel class. For economy class passengers, the standard baggage allowance is typically 20 kilograms. However, premium economy, business class, and first class passengers may have higher allowances, often ranging from 30 to 40 kilograms.

Frequent flyers and members of PAL's loyalty program may be entitled to additional baggage allowances. It's worth checking with the airline or reviewing their website to understand the specific benefits available to you.

Cabin Baggage Allowance

For cabin baggage, Philippine Airlines has specific restrictions on size and weight. Typically, the maximum weight allowed is 7 kilograms, and the dimensions should not exceed a certain limit to fit in the overhead compartments. Passengers are usually allowed one main cabin bag and a smaller personal item, such as a laptop bag or purse.

Special Items and Sports Equipment

If you need to transport special items such as musical instruments, fragile items, or sports equipment, Philippine Airlines has specific policies in place. Musical instruments, for instance, may be allowed as cabin baggage if they meet the size and weight restrictions. Fragile items may require additional packaging or handling instructions to ensure their safety during transit. Sports equipment, on the other hand, may have specific guidelines and fees associated with their transportation. It's recommended to contact the airline in advance to understand the requirements and any additional charges for transporting these items.

FAQs

Can I purchase additional baggage allowance?

Yes, Philippine Airlines offers the option to purchase additional baggage allowance. You can check their website or contact their customer service for more information on the process and associated fees.

Can I carry my pet as checked baggage?

Yes, Philippine Airlines allows the transportation of pets as checked baggage, subject to specific regulations and requirements. It's advisable to contact the airline in advance to understand the guidelines and make necessary arrangements.

Are there any restrictions on carrying liquids in cabin baggage?

Yes, like most airlines, Philippine Airlines follows the restrictions on carrying liquids in cabin baggage. Liquids should be in containers of 100 milliliters or less, and all containers must fit in a clear, resealable plastic bag.

What should I do if my baggage is damaged?

In case of damaged baggage, report the issue to the airline's baggage service desk immediately. They will guide you through the necessary steps to file a claim and resolve the matter.
